## Environment Variables — Liftgrid Simulator

Liftgrid simulates elevator dispatch across configurable building profiles. `LIFTGRID_FLOORS` sets floor count (default 20). `LIFTGRID_ALGO` selects dispatch strategy: `nearest`, `zoned`, or `swarm`. `LIFTGRID_TICK_MS` controls sim resolution; keep ≥50 for reproducible runs. Telemetry export is off unless `LIFTGRID_TELEMETRY=1`, in which case the sim posts run summaries to the Shaftboard collector. That export path is authenticated, and the collector credential goes on the next line.

sealed setting: VAULT_KEY20=c8ea1e419912889df6b4

### v4.2.0 — Signing Key Rotation

This release rotates the artifact signing key for Nightshade, the dark-mode theming layer in the Copperfield admin dashboard. The previous key reached its scheduled end of life; no compromise occurred. For new team members: theme bundles are signed independently of the dashboard core, so you must update the verification key in your local tooling or older and newer bundles will fail checks inconsistently. All artifacts from v4.2.0 onward verify against the key below.

rollout seal: bky4_x7Gc

To the incoming director. The Quillbrook franchise agreement signed last month grants exclusive rights across the Sarnholt district for seven years. Royalty: 5% of gross, quarterly. Franchisee funds fit-out; we supply training and the Quillbrook brand kit. Renewal option requires performance above threshold in years five and six. Two open items: signage compliance and the supply-pricing schedule, both due before launch. Familiarise yourself with the strategic consideration recorded immediately below this memo.

internal memo for fajog-yagaf: Gross margin on Ulaael came in at 20 percent against a plan of 10 percent. Only 9 of the 80 pilot accounts renewed Ulaael, so a churn review is set for July 1.